python 多執行緒和多進程在未來發展中具有廣闊的前景。隨著電腦硬體的不斷發展,多核心處理器已成為主流。多執行緒和多進程可以充分利用多核心處理器的優勢,提高程式的運作效率。
1. 多執行緒的發展趨勢
Python 多執行緒的發展趨勢主要體現在以下幾個方面:
2. 多進程的發展趨勢
Python 多進程的發展趨勢主要體現在以下幾個方面:
3. 如何掌握並發程式設計的尖端技術
#要掌握並發程式設計的尖端技術,可以從以下幾個面向著手:
4. 演示程式碼
## 多线程示例 import threading def task(i): print(f"Task {i} is running.") if __name__ == "__main__": threads = [] for i in range(5): thread = threading.Thread(target=task, args=(i,)) threads.append(thread) thread.start() for thread in threads: thread.join() # 多进程示例 import multiprocessing def task(i): print(f"Task {i} is running.") if __name__ == "__main__": processes = [] for i in range(5): process = multiprocessing.Process(target=task, args=(i,)) processes.append(process) process.start() for process in processes: process.join()
5. 結論
#Python 多執行緒和多進程是常用的並發程式設計手段,在未來發展中具有廣闊的前景。隨著電腦硬體的不斷發展,多核心處理器已成為主流。多執行緒和多進程可以充分利用多核心處理器的優勢,提高程式的運作效率。要掌握並發程式設計的尖端技術,可以從學習最新的並發程式技術、關注並發程式設計領域的最新研究成果、實踐並發程式技術等方面著手。
以上是Python 多執行緒與多進程:未來發展趨勢,掌握並發程式設計的尖端技術的詳細內容。更多資訊請關注PHP中文網其他相關文章!